    Yeah so that's there for you to keep track of how many EV's you've gotten from hordes so far. So if you're fighting hordes and training one pokemon at a time carring a power item, each horde gives 25 points in a respected EV. And if you're carrying a Macho Brace, each horde will give you 10, and without a training item, each one gives you 5. after that, for stats that you're not maxing out (you'll be hitting some weird ones with Bisharp for sure), you can either Super Train or fight individual Pokemon for precision.

    So the first thing I'd do if you're gonna be EV training a lot in the future is start collecting Battle Points so that you can get power accessories and a Macho Brace at the Battle Maison. You can get quite a few from the Pokemon Bank and also by winning challenges at the Battle Maison.
